not recognising mp3 cd-r's
I just burnt 6 cdr- 800mb/90 mins (overburn).
I insert any of the 6 burnt mp3 cd's into my car cd/mp3/wma player which is a Pioneer DEH-P4650MP But for some reason it won't recognise any of the tracks. Just displayes "NO AUDIO" I know there is nothing wrong with the cd's as they play fine on the following, Phillips dvd player, Pioneer dvd player, xbox, computer cd/dvd rom and portable mp3 walkman They are HiCO brand 90min/800mb cdr I have used this brand in the past, never had a problem and have always burnt the cd's with Nero 6. Any clues as to why the car player is not recognising these cdr's anymore would be appreciated.? |

Problem solved
The acrual version of nero I was Using (6.6.0.7) had a few bugs in it. As noted my HU wouldn't recognise all the burned cdrs I just made. Also discovered the .ISO image burning bug as well. Just upgraded to nero 6.6.0.12 overburnt some more cdrs (exactly the same way) and the Head Unit recognises them Now I'll just have to copy all the cdrs back to my hard disk and reburn them again. Just wasted 8 cds because of these bugs. .. Greg "Spike" wrote in message ...
